This image shows a green-toned sketch of a woman’s face and shoulders turned slightly away. Her hair is loose, framing her profile. The background is a faint, textured pattern, almost like brushstrokes or watercolor smudges. The print is labeled as a program cover for *Théâtre de "L'Oeuvre"* from 1895, which suggests it’s tied to a specific play or performance.
